Night in the Library

Night in the Library is one of the most uniquely New York activities around. On March 14th, 2026, the Brooklyn Library will open its doors for a free after-hours festival featuring art, discussions and movie screenings at its Grand Army Plaza location. Since the event takes place on Pi Day, the theme is “The Philosophy of Mathematics” and the hours at 7pm until 3:14 am. The key speaker will be Werner Herzog.

St. Patrick’s Day

Did you know that New York City has the oldest St. Patrick’s Day Parade in the world? The 265th New York City St. Patrick’s Day Parade will take place Tuesday, March 17, 2026 at 11 am. As always, the parade will take place along Fifth Avenue and march past St. Patrick’s Cathedral.This year’s Grand Marshal is Robert James “Bob” McCann who has built a distinguished career in financial services. Women’s History Month

March is Women’s History Month, and there are many events throughout the city. A notable celebration offered by The New York Public Library is free floral design workshops in both Staten Island and the Bronx. As is the case with most NYC events, it is recommended you pre-register.

Free Ice Skating

As winter comes to a close, so does the outdoor ice skating season. Wollman Rink in Central Park still has some tricks up its sleeve. To celebrate the 75th anniversary of Wollman Rink, it will host three days of free ice skating. The family-friendly event takes place from March 20-22.
